Ah, I am playing through SO2 for the millionth time ATM. I have good childhood memories w/ it. The story is definitely hard to follow if you haven't played both stories. Tons of replay value, though. I would suggest playing again and trying to get secret characters (Opera&Ernest, Precis, Ashton, Dias/Leon, Chisato) and do PA's in most towns at different points in the story.

For Action/Adventure, Crystal Chronicles might suit you, it's kind of a mix between that and RPG. Good RPG gateway, anyways. The Metroid game for the Gamecube is pretty good, although I've never finished it. Starfox is excellent. Sonic Adventure 1&2 are also good choices. You seem to like Mario games, so Luigi's Mansion could be good for you. I believe they have a few Spyro games for the gamecube/Wii, they are a solid choice, along with Crash Bandicoot games. Splinter Cell is for the Gamecube iirc, but then you are stepping in to shooter games.

For the Wii, there is a plethora of Sonic games (and Mario ones) if that's your thing. Monster Hunter Tri I've heard is good, never played it though.

That's all I can think of, you've tapped me for Action/Adventure.
